Commit Graph

102 Commits

Author SHA1 Message Date
Evan You 06ca479b87 chore: bump vue-loader 2018-05-10 23:59:12 -04:00
Evan You 2dcdeddde4 feat: upgrade to webpack 4
BREAKING CHANGE: Upgrade wepback 4, all webpack option
modifications must be webpcak 4 compatible. Drop support
for webpack plugins that do not work with v4 or above.
2018-05-08 16:55:13 -04:00
Evan You 6d4e51dd18 feat: remove DLL option
BREAKING CHANGE: dll option has been removed.
2018-05-07 17:27:40 -04:00
Evan You 6d807e0139 chore: update lockfile 2018-05-03 17:05:15 -04:00
Evan You f69231f478 test(serve): test proxy option 2018-05-03 15:42:42 -04:00
Evan You feb3857f78 chore: bump fs-extra version 2018-05-02 18:52:01 -04:00
Evan You 0f73a91162 refactor: use fs-extra 2018-04-30 18:19:02 -04:00
Evan You 8426fb84af chore: update lockfile 2018-04-30 17:17:59 -04:00
Evan You 719dfbe319 chore: refresh deps 2018-04-27 19:32:43 -04:00
Evan You cbc83672ef chore: pin root babel-core version 2018-04-25 10:51:12 -04:00
Evan You c9d7feffa1 chore: upgrade deps 2018-04-25 10:48:46 -04:00
Evan You dbc3f104b0 fix: pin babel version (fix #1162) 2018-04-25 10:18:43 -04:00
Evan You 03fed35704 chore: bump vue-loader 2018-03-07 02:38:31 -05:00
Evan You 2549257e21 chore: update yarn.lock 2018-03-06 12:53:02 -05:00
Evan You 3894308af7 chore: bump deps 2018-03-06 11:52:48 -05:00
Evan You 2eb1ef97e4 fix: fix babel preset jsx dependency 2018-03-05 18:09:50 -05:00
Evan You 41fee59d56 chore: update yarn.lock 2018-03-05 17:47:08 -05:00
Evan You dbbc96bacc chore: upgrade globby 2018-03-05 12:32:36 -05:00
Evan You 2d89c51c27 feat: support using remote preset (close #884) 2018-03-05 10:56:24 -05:00
Evan You 1869aa2a20 feat: Generator now supports template inheritance 2018-03-03 18:32:53 -05:00
Evan You 09ed0b168a feat: support dynamic import in jest tests (close #922) 2018-03-02 21:52:08 -05:00
Evan You 89982dff04 fix: fix baseUrl normalization (close #900) 2018-03-02 21:40:48 -05:00
Evan You 6e4870c6a1 chore: bump deps & fix tests 2018-02-28 17:08:12 -05:00
Giovanni Condello 6d7985a2e3 feat(cli-plugin-pwa): Upgrade workbox-webpack-plugin to 3.0.0-beta.1 (#897) 2018-02-28 08:01:54 -05:00
Evan You 90fd33a4ea chore: update yarn.lock 2018-02-12 16:42:31 -05:00
Evan You 9410442138 feat: use eslint-plugin-cypress
close #815
2018-02-12 15:56:52 -05:00
Evan You dd04add39e feat: support using ESLint to lint TypeScript 2018-02-07 15:46:59 -05:00
Evan You f7d273dd4a refactor: use axios for registry ping 2018-02-06 17:46:00 -05:00
Evan You 46166fb640 fix: handle vue invoke config merging for existing files
close #788
2018-02-06 16:02:09 -05:00
Evan You 4292d05e74 chore: update yarn.lock 2018-02-03 21:35:46 -05:00
Evan You 764dd5fd6d chore: bump deps 2018-02-02 03:09:05 -05:00
Evan You 9a07eebea5 feat: complete --target wc & multi-wc + tests 2018-02-02 00:56:27 -05:00
Evan You 29557a73df chore: add @vue/web-component-wrapper 2018-02-01 18:05:46 -05:00
Evan You 0f59c03985 feat: vue build --target multi-wc [pattern] 2018-02-01 15:12:32 -05:00
Evan You 1c4943b6ec feat: improve build lib/web-component 2018-02-01 15:12:32 -05:00
Evan You 98afd07017 feat: inject styles under shadow root in web component mode 2018-01-31 00:07:57 -05:00
Evan You 5be05f34d2 fix: fix project creation when path contains spaces (fix #742) 2018-01-29 17:41:13 -05:00
Evan You b8f24872bf feat: parallel mode 2018-01-29 16:23:02 -05:00
Evan You 9856549432 refactor: refactor shared utils + move openBrowser 2018-01-27 21:54:27 -05:00
Evan You 01edb46b8c feat: support config in dedicated files 2018-01-27 17:03:31 -05:00
Evan You 61b93a68fd refactor: improve installation progress 2018-01-26 17:07:55 -05:00
Evan You 2d6a0d9752 fix: temp pinning vue-jest to github branch 2018-01-26 16:12:15 -05:00
Evan You 3bd447a4d6 fix: pin joi to 12.x for node version compat 2018-01-26 13:37:55 -05:00
Evan You 46805444e5 feat: use cache-loader for ts 2018-01-25 15:10:31 -05:00
Evan You 7471f949cf fix: clone options before mutating 2018-01-25 13:55:29 -05:00
Evan You c769110971 fix: use babel-loader@8 2018-01-25 12:03:37 -05:00
Evan You f52ff70ba5 fix: bump root deps as well 2018-01-25 10:37:48 -05:00
Evan You 09ef536ff6 chore: bump deps 2018-01-25 00:07:12 -05:00
Evan You 8a3ac7e170 feat: e2e cypress 2018-01-24 21:59:29 -05:00
Evan You 8dff383841 feat: auto DLL 2018-01-24 20:24:43 -05:00